About The Author
Mary Beard
Mary Beard is Professor Emerita of Classics at Cambridge and the Classics Editor of the TLS. She has worldwide academic acclaim. Her previous books include the bestselling, Wolfson Prize-winning Pompeii, Confronting the Classics, SPQR, Women & Power, and most recently, Emperor of Rome. She has made numerous television series and her books have been published in over thirty languages.
